Global is seeking a Media Executive to join their National Sales team in Greater London. In this role, you will be responsible for planning and booking airtime and DAX advertising campaigns, working closely with media agencies.

The ideal candidate will have a can-do attitude, excellent attention to detail, and the ability to build strong relationships with clients. This is a fantastic opportunity for those looking to progress in a media sales career.
